  • Originally from Ireland, Anne Bonny's family traveled to the new world very early on in her life and she eventually settled in the Bahamas. While in the Bahamas, Bonny began to spend time with pirates in the local taverns. There she met Jack "Calico Jack" Rackham, captain of the Revenge, and became his mistress and joined his crew. Rackham's crew later added another female pirate named Mary Read. Bonny was initially attracted to Read thinking she was a handsome man. Captain Rackham became jealous of Read and threatened to kill her. This forced Read to reveal that she was in fact a woman. Once learning her secret though, Rackham allowed both women to remain on the crew. In October 1720, Rackham's pirates were captured and taken to Jamaica, where they were convicted and sentenced by the Governor of Jamaica to be hung, but Read and Bonny both "pleaded their bellies": asking for mercy because they were pregnant so their execution was stalled. There is no historical record of Bonny's release or of her execution.

  • Anne Bonny (sometimes spelled 'Bonney') was an 18th century Irish pirate and arguably the most famous real life version of a Pirate Girl. Born in Kinsale, Ireland, Anne had a rocky start in life. She was the illegitimate daughter of lawyer William Cormac and his maid. For the first several years of her life, her father tried to pass her off as a boy, the son of a relative to prevent scandal. When her true identity was revealed the family was so ruined by the fallout that they ended up leaving Ireland for a new life in America. In America, Anne ended up marrying a poor sailor and part-time pirate named James Bonny - and was disowned by her father for her choice (legend has it she set fire to her father's plantation in retaliation.) The two moved to New Providence in the Bahamas, where James turned informant for the governor and Anne turned to pirate captain John "Calico Jack" Rackham. When James found about the affair, he took her to the governor, demanding she be flogged for adultery. Rackham offered to buy her divorce from her husband, but it was Anne who refused - incensed at the idea of "bought and sold like cattle." She and Rackham managed to escape and, with the help of another female pirate, Mary Reade, she stole Rackham's ship from Nassau harbour and took to the seas, recruiting a crew. Interestingly, given the way she was raised, Anne Bonny didn't disguise herself as a man during her career as a pirate - her gender was public knowledge. Eventually, Rackham's ship was attacked by an English sloop and most of the crew (Rackham included) put up only token resistance. Anne, on the other hand, resisted fiercely, aided only by Mary Reade and one other pirate. She doesn't appear to have been happy at Rackham's lack of fighting spirit as when the two confronted each other in jail in Jamaica while awaiting execution, she told him she was "sorry to see him there, but if he had fought like a Man, he need not have been hang'd like a Dog." Anne Bonny herself escaped execution thanks to being pregnant with Rackham's child, and then being ransomed by her father. Historians are divided on what happened next but her career as a pirate at least was over.

  • Anne Bonny was born Anne Cormac in County Cork, Ireland. Mary Brennan, her mother was the daughter of a servant woman who had an affair with her employer, lawyer William Cormac. His wife soon discovered the affair and William Cormac, Mary Brennan, and a young Anne crossed the Atlantic to flee the scandal. They settled in Charleston, Carolina. Anne was soon bored with life on her father's plantation, and was drawn to a life of adventure. Before Anne was out of her teens she married James Bonny, a renegade seaman and sometimes pirate. At this time pirates frequented Charleston. James planned to steal William Cormac's land through the marriage but Anne's father disowned her before this could be done. Legend has it that in retaliation, Anne burned the plantation to the ground. They fled to the Bahamas and settled on the island of New Providence back then. James proved a coward and a traitor, became a paid snitch for the governor. Anne preferred the company of the island's notorious pirates and women and soon distanced herself from James.
